首页 > 其他 > 详细

虚拟机EAL: Error reading from file descriptor

时间:2017-01-03 11:31:19      阅读:1257      评论:0      收藏:0      [点我收藏+]
这个是虚拟机安装固有的BUG,代码差异如下:
  1. diff --git a/lib/librte_eal/linuxapp/igb_uio/igb_uio.c b/lib/librte_eal/linuxapp/igb_uio/igb_uio.c
  2. index d1ca26e..c46a00f 100644
  3. --- a/lib/librte_eal/linuxapp/igb_uio/igb_uio.c
  4. +++ b/lib/librte_eal/linuxapp/igb_uio/igb_uio.c
  5. @@ -505,14 +505,11 @@ igbuio_pci_probe(struct pci_dev *dev, const struct pci_device_id *id)
  6. }
  7. /* fall back to INTX */
  8. case RTE_INTR_MODE_LEGACY:
  9. - if (pci_intx_mask_supported(dev)) {
  10. - dev_dbg(&dev->dev, "using INTX");
  11. - udev->info.irq_flags = IRQF_SHARED;
  12. - udev->info.irq = dev->irq;
  13. - udev->mode = RTE_INTR_MODE_LEGACY;
  14. - break;
  15. - }
  16. - dev_notice(&dev->dev, "PCI INTX mask not supported\n");
  17. + dev_dbg(&dev->dev, "using INTX");
  18. + udev->info.irq_flags = IRQF_SHARED;
  19. + udev->info.irq = dev->irq;
  20. + udev->mode = RTE_INTR_MODE_LEGACY;
  21. + break;
  22. /* fall back to no IRQ */
  23. case RTE_INTR_MODE_NONE:
  24. udev->mode = RTE_INTR_MODE_NONE;
技术分享
 





虚拟机EAL: Error reading from file descriptor

原文:http://www.cnblogs.com/yml435/p/6244051.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!